The Origins and Benefits of Ashwagandha
Ashwagandha, often dubbed "Indian ginseng," has been cherished in Ayurvedic medicine for over 3,000 years. This powerful herb is renowned for its adaptogenic properties, enabling our bodies to better handle stress. Its roots promise a blend of benefits including improved sleep, enhanced cognitive function, and immune support, making it a holistic choice for families looking to boost overall health.
Unlocking the Secrets: What Ashwagandha Offers
- Reduces Stress: Perhaps its most celebrated benefit, ashwagandha tea is known for lowering cortisol levels and promoting relaxation. For busy households juggling work, school, and home life, sipping on this tea can provide a moment of calm.
- Boosts Immunity: Packed with antioxidants, regular consumption of ashwagandha tea helps fortify the immune system, keeping both adults and children healthy during cold and flu season.
- Improves Sleep Quality: Struggles with restless nights? Ashwagandha tea soothes the nervous system, facilitating deeper and more restorative sleep, which is essential for busy parents and professionals alike.
How to Incorporate Ashwagandha Tea into Your Routine
Adding ashwagandha tea to your daily routine is simple. It can be steeped like any herbal tea and enjoyed plain or with honey and lemon for added flavor.
